About Technical Recruiter roles

The Technical Recruiter job market currently shows 79 open positions across 51 hiring companies, according to available data. With 7 new roles posted in the most recent week, hiring activity appears to be ongoing, though the volume of new postings is modest relative to the total open roles. This suggests a market with steady but measured turnover in listings rather than rapid expansion. Compensation data drawn from posted listings shows a median (P50) salary of $166,250 for Technical Recruiter roles. The 25th percentile stands at $156,875, while the 75th percentile reaches $170,000. This relatively narrow band between the 25th and 75th percentiles suggests a degree of consistency in how companies are compensating for this role, at least among postings that disclose salary information. Among the companies actively hiring for Technical Recruiter positions, TRM Labs, Brex, Hightouch, Astranis, and Jeeves appear as top hiring companies based on current postings. These organizations span different sectors, from fintech to aerospace to data infrastructure, indicating that the demand for technical recruiting talent is not confined to a single industry vertical. Overall, the data reflects a job market with a defined but limited pool of opportunities—79 open roles spread across 51 companies means an average of roughly 1.5 open positions per hiring company. This distribution suggests that while many companies maintain a presence in the market for technical recruiting talent, most are not hiring in high volume simultaneously.
